Madden 2005 vs ESPN NFL 2K5
I wanted a Football game but I couldn't decide which one so I got both. After playing more than 10 games for each title I have to say ESPN NFL 2K5 is better. <
> <
>ESPN has better presentation. Madden's presentation is lame. The play menu takes up more than half of the bottom TV screen, so you all see is players' top half, their legs looks chopped off. To make things worse, whenever you scroll thru the playbook the action gets paused a bit which makes all action choppy. ESPN has better looking cheerleaders and they do different things. Madden's cheerleaders have only one look type and she is ugly and has Bugs Bunny teeth and its the same sorry ass scene everytime. Madden's game intro always show players with their helmets on during pre-game exercise, ESPN players have face and hair!! ESPN's replay engine is better too, it shows the entire play, unlike Madden's which shows pieces of play. <
> <
>Graphically ESPN is better. You can see vent holes on players' jersey. Madden's stadium/background graphic is a bit more clean, for example the banners and jumbotrons look sharper but this is because Madden's camera engine has NO side and iso views. ESPN has side and iso views, so its understandable that the stadium/background graphic is lesser, but just a bit if any. ESPN's animation is smooth. In Madden 2005 the animation is often choppy. Especially in demo mode. <
> <
>Both games are not perfect, both have bad and good points. <
> <
>Gameplaywise Madden is very arcadey, it kinda plays like Madden on Genesis. On offense you can zip your pass for completion almost everytime in any situation, even into the mass pile of players at the line of scrimmage. You can basically complete your pass to anyone anytime. ESPN's gameplay is more simulation and realistic, you can't zip your pass like Madden else it will be incomplete or intercepted. You have to read the player's route and wait for the right time to pass. In Madden, quarterbacks pass to the receiver; In ESPN, quarterbacks pass to "the spot" of the route. Running game in Madden is horrible, you get tackled when you get near opposing players. Madden's running game feels like flag football. The running game in Madden just simply don't work that well. ESPN's running game is much better and realistic, you can bump off, spin, and power your way thru other players. Overall ESPN's passing and running game has good balance and both can and will be used in games. In Madden the passing game dwarfs the glitched running game. <
> <
>Another thing I noticed is that ESPN has more player pictures! Roethlisberger and Eli Manning got pics in ESPN but none in Madden. <
> <
>I purchased Madden 2005 because of the price drop. I was not impressed with Madden so I purchased NFL 2K5 for $20 the same night(even after so many months since its release). Im glad that I tried ESPN 2k5, it is better than Madden 2005. I will be returning my Madden 2005 tommorrow.


warning! Review for 2005 and madden 2006
I am taking my time to write a honest review about this game. If you are those kind of people who like games who resemble the real life then this game is not for you. <
> <
>The NEGATIVES (which are more then the positives by the way). <
> <
>* IN real life when teams are on offense most of the time DEFENSES get tired. Well, in madden 2005 and 2006 that is not the case, if your offense is on the field most of the time your offense gets tired and their defense gets stronger. <
> <
>*When the computer wants to score there is NOTHING you can do. Even If your CB is covering, the ball will go through his body and the WR will catch it ( i have never seen that in other games like ESPN). <
> <
>*As we all know in MADDEN players are rated by an overall number. IN madden 2005 and 2006 for example if your defense is agains the computer you have a big disadvantage one single offensive linemen can block 3 (99 overall) players of your defense. <
> <
>*The most ridiculus part of this game is when a CPU player is running in one direction and then accelerates in the ooposite direction and tackles your player and the block at the same time. <
> <
> <
>I can keep going on and on and tell you why after 5 minutes this game is not fun anymore, but the negatives are so many that I would need days to review this games (2005 and 2006). <
> <
>If you ask yourself why am I including madden 2006 in my review? I do it because i have a friend who is a game tester and he told me that the gameplay of Madden 2006 is exactly the same as the 2005. <
>Personally i am done with the MADDEN series until thye re-disign the gameplay and it resembles more to real life.
